What is the coldest month in Krakow?

Winter in Kraków The winters are usually very cold in Kraków and during December, January and February there are approximately 12 snowy days a month. The coldest month is January, when temperatures drop to between -5ºC (23ºF) and 1ºC (34ºF).

What is the best month to visit Krakow?

The best times to visit Kraków are from March to May and between September and November. The weather is pleasant and the summer's throngs of tourists are nowhere to be found. July and August's weather often climbs into the mid-70s, while the average low in January is in the low 20s.

Is there a Christmas market in Krakow?

“Kraków's market is one of the most picture-perfect settings for a Christmas market that you can imagine,” wrote Christmas Tree World. The market, which starts on 24 November and lasts 33 days, is located on the medieval market square in Kraków's UNESCO-listed old town.

How much is a taxi from Kraków Airport to city center?

Krakow airport taxi rides on average will cost around 22€ (90PLN) and take 30 minutes for the trip. There are two bus lines along with a night bus operating from the airport; the day trips take around 50 minutes while the night ride just 30 minutes to the centre of the city. All one way tickets cost 1€ (4PLN).

How do you get from Krakow airport to city Centre?

How can I get to the city centre? Three municipal bus lines (208, 252 and 902 - a night line) run from Kraków Airport. Furthermore a train operated by Koleje Małopolskie will take you to the Main Railway Station in Kraków and to Wieliczka. Alternatively, you can use the services of Kraków Airport Taxi.

How much is a pint in Krakow?

When you visit pubs and restaurants, the average price of a beer in the Market Square area is around 15 zł or 3.50 € (about 30% of the cost of a beer in London, which averages at 8.00 €). With this in mind, it's worth noting that Krakow is considered one of the cheaper cities in the world for beer lovers.

Why is it so cold in Krakow?

The climate in Kraków is temperate since it has both an oceanic and continental climate, meaning that it has cold winters and mild summers. It rains all year round in Kraków and sometimes quite heavily. The average rainy days in winter are 7 days a month and in spring it climbs up to 16 days a month.

Is Krakow snowy at Christmas?

The average temperature in December is -1°C with peaks of just 2°C at midday. Snowfall is possible because of the low temperatures and there's a 50% chance it'll snow during your visit. This is great if you've come to Krakow to celebrate Christmas and don't mind a touch of frost in the morning.

Can Euros be used in Krakow?

A few bars and tourist companies in Kraków and Warsaw will accept Euros but most of the time you won't be able to pay with Euros in Poland. The few companies that do accept Euro probably won't be able to give a very competitive rate, so it's better to simply pay in Złoty.
